Mission Solar Energy is a US-based manufacturer in San Antonio, Texas, producing modules for the North American market. Technical specifications for the Mission Solar MSN10-560HN4G: maximum power 560W, efficiency 21.88%, Vmp 42V, Voc 50.7V, Isc 14.11A. This Monocrystalline module carries a 30-year warranty.

Technical Specifications
Open Circuit Voltage (Voc)50.7V
Short Circuit Current (Isc)14.11A
Voltage at Pmax (Vmp)42V
Current at Pmax (Imp)13.34A
Temp. Coefficient of Pmax-0.297%/°C
Dimensions2055 x 1246 x 35 mm
Weight32.0kg
NOCT43°C
PTC Rating537.7W

FAQ

What is the max power output of the Mission Solar MSN10-560HN4G?

The Mission Solar MSN10-560HN4G is rated at 560W under STC (1000 W/m², 25°C, AM 1.5).

What warranty does Mission Solar provide?

Mission Solar offers a 30-year warranty for the MSN10-560HN4G, reflecting confidence in long-term durability.

How does temperature affect the Mission Solar MSN10-560HN4G?

With a temp coefficient of -0.297%/°C, it outperforms the industry average of -0.35 to -0.40%/°C.

What are the dimensions and weight of the Mission Solar MSN10-560HN4G?

It measures 2055 x 1246 x 35 mm and weighs 32.0kg.
